JOB SUMMARY :

The Executive Assistant is responsible for providing day to day administrative support to the Divisional Director of Development.

The Executive Assistant must possess strong organizational skills with a keen eye for detail. The Executive Assistant must be flexible and able to handle multiple priorities simultaneously, have good judgment, be able to work independently or with little supervision, be self-motivated, able to set priorities and apply excellent time management skills.
